Easy, Custom “Hello” Banner!

This fun idea spells out “hello” – something perfect for a door, entry, hallway, or even mantel. Like yesterday’s project, this is an easy project combining my brand new “Cottage Living” paper & embellishments collection (part of my Home + Made line) with special wood pieces specifically designed by The Wood Connection to match the paper.

home.made.banner.h.detail

Here’s how easy it is to make – and you can adapt for you!

Thanks to my amazing neighbor Amy Dott, we used custom pieces of wood from the Wood Connection sized to make a perfect background for the customizable banner letters in the new paper line.

We used spray adhesive (this time) to adhere one of the Home + Made Cottage Living papers to the background pieces.

Then we trimmed carefully with a very sharp craft knife to fit the paper to the wood.

We used foam, double-sided adhesive squares to attach the banner letters to the background and then used ribbon to tie the letters together.

I love how it’s a banner I can use year-round … and I could adapt it to work for anything, even my word of the year!
